Our modern age of nihilism, or meaninglessness, reaches its end when the bearer of meaning, Being, gradually concealed from view over the passage of centuries, is now completely forgotten. Objects are now understood only in terms of their efficiency and ordered-ness, or as mere enhancements to our lives, but never as "portals" to the infinite depths of Being. Three friends confront this 'catastrophe' and each undergoes a moment of inception in which a new configuration of the world becomes possible. Two of them attempt to bring this new configuration into actuality via an art form, while the third refuses and instead participates in the inevitable culmination of our technological civilisation. my essay, The Hidden Legacy of The Red Book, was first published in: Thomas Arzt (Hrsg.): Das Rote Buch.
